Opponents of Cobourg Mayor Lucas Cleveland are calling for his resignation over a June statement in which Cleveland called the homeless shelter a failure of public policy and that the general public are no longer going to accept the criminality, chaos, and unaccountability.

A protest was held at Victoria Hall last week, where community activist Theresa Rickerby stated that Cleveland needs to be accountable for his language and actions.
